Sherwood Parish Church isn’t just a building. It’s a living chronicle of Paisley’s history. Built in 1891-2 by architect James Donald its Free perpendicular Gothic style is breathtaking. It’s a significant part of Paisley’s cultural heritage.

The original church cost a mere $7000. That’s a pittance compared to the cost of similar buildings today. The larger halls and furnishings added later cost an additional $8760. Even the stained-glass windows added by Stephen Adam in 1920 only added $600 to the overall budget.

The church underwent significant changes. Architect Hamilton Neil expanded the building in 1925. The spire wasn’t completed until 1927. The intricate details are remarkable. Notice the pointed archways the slender spire and the beautiful stained glass. It’s a feast for the eyes.

The interior is just as impressive as the exterior. The gallery wraps around the sides and rear. Cast-iron colonnettes adorn the ground floor. Corinthian and Composite columns rise above. The arched brace collar beam roof is a masterful piece of craftsmanship.
